WebThe best way to prevent unauthorized credit inquiries is to stay on top of your credit profile. There are a fewwaysto go about this: Credit Monitoring: this is a great way to know what’s going on in your credit profile at all times. When you enroll, you will receive instant alerts via email or text of any activity in your credit profile. WebDec 12, 2024 · Here are three ways to stop trigger lead harassment: Put your name and phone number on the National Do Not Call Registry. You can register your cell phone number as well. Do this at least a month before you apply for a loan because it takes 31 days to become effective. Once you register your phone number, the registration never expires. WebDisputes and Credit Inquiries. Credit inquiries occur when someone with a valid business reason, or permissible purpose, checks your credit report. All inquiries stay on your credit report for two years. If you don't recognize an inquiry, you should contact the company that checked your credit using the contact information in your credit report ...

WebAll inquiries on your credit report within a 14-day period will count as one inquiry if you are looking for a mortgage to purchase a home, a mortgage to refinance your home, a home equity loan or line of credit or an auto loan. If you are looking for a personal loan or credit card, however, each inquiry will be counted as a separate inquiry. WebYou can cancel the automatic renew feature of a 90-day or extended alert online if you subscribe to Equifax's credit monitoring service and created the alert from your Equifax account. From your Member Center homepage, select the Alerts tab. Scroll down and from the Automatic Fraud Alert window, select the "deactivate fraud alert" button.
